Nederland - windmotor De Veenhoop
Windmotor De Veenhoop is a polder windmill near the Frisian village of De Veenhoop. It is a so called American windmill (in the Netherlands also called roosmolen). This type of windmills was developed in the United States and was used for irrigation purposes. In the Netherlands, these mills are used as polder mills. De Veenhoop is of the brand Herkules and was built in the German city of Dresden.
From 1921 to 1962, the mill was used for draining a nearby polder. The mill was sold, but in 1996 it was in very poor condition. Five years later, the mill was refurbished and used again at its present location to drain the Groote Veenpolder.
